(每日一词)furtive


furtive

adjective 

UK   /ˈfɜː.tɪv/ 

US   /ˈfɝː.t̬ɪv/


meaning: 

(of people) behaving secretly and often dishonestly, or (of actions) done secretly and often dishonestly (人)偷偷摸摸的;鬼鬼祟祟的;(行动)秘密的



例句:I saw him cast a furtive glance at the woman at the table to his right. 我看到他偷偷地扫了一眼坐在他右手桌子旁的女人。

例句:He made one or two furtive phone calls. 他鬼鬼祟祟地打了一两个电话。

例句:There was something furtive about his behaviour and I immediately felt suspicious. 他鬼鬼祟祟的,我马上觉得有些可疑。
